Product Description
The HP AE179A is a high-performance 3.5-inch hard drive engineered for demanding enterprise storage applications. With a substantial 300GB capacity, it provides ample space for critical data. The drive utilizes a 4Gb/s Fibre Channel interface, which is a standard for Storage Area Networks (SANs), offering high bandwidth and low latency for efficient data transfer between servers and storage arrays. Operating at a rapid 15000 RPM spindle speed, this drive delivers exceptional performance, significantly reducing seek times and improving overall I/O operations. This makes it ideal for mission-critical applications that require fast access to data, such as databases, transaction processing systems, and high-performance computing environments. The 16MB cache buffer further enhances performance by temporarily storing frequently accessed data. Built for enterprise environments, the HP AE179A is designed for continuous operation and high reliability, offering the endurance required for 24/7 workloads. Its 3.5-inch form factor is standard for many enterprise storage enclosures and arrays.
